Output c8fc646915c5f1d71f2f1180bdcc02eb1f6aa1e0e203f9baeed3d5a0178ba510:1

value
24873428743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 818c502a2606ce84b8fe09da30c49f35c02297cb OP_EQUAL
address
MKi9VJcHsx4kKBqA3PuYjgEiNHa8EZXVwB
transaction
c8fc646915c5f1d71f2f1180bdcc02eb1f6aa1e0e203f9baeed3d5a0178ba510
spent
true